When comparing Profound RF and Morpheus8, both are advanced skin rejuvenation treatments, but they differ in their mechanisms and target areas. Profound RF uses radiofrequency energy to stimulate collagen and elastin production deep within the skin, making it particularly effective for addressing loose skin and wrinkles. It is often favored for its ability to provide long-lasting results, especially in areas like the jawline and neck.
On the other hand, Morpheus8 combines microneedling with radiofrequency energy. This dual approach allows it to penetrate deeper into the skin, promoting collagen production and remodeling the skin's structure. Morpheus8 is versatile and can be used on various body parts, including the face, abdomen, and thighs, making it a popular choice for those seeking comprehensive skin tightening and rejuvenation.
Ultimately, the choice between Profound RF and Morpheus8 depends on individual needs and the specific areas of concern. Consulting with a skincare professional can help determine which treatment is more suitable for achieving the desired results.

Understanding the Differences Between Profound RF and Morpheus8
When it comes to non-invasive skin rejuvenation treatments, two names often come up: Profound RF and Morpheus8. Both are advanced technologies designed to address skin concerns such as wrinkles, acne scars, and loss of elasticity. However, each has its unique approach and benefits.
Technology and Mechanism
Profound RF uses a combination of radiofrequency (RF) energy and microneedling to stimulate collagen and elastin production. The RF energy heats the deeper layers of the skin, promoting tissue remodeling and new collagen formation. This dual action helps to tighten the skin and improve its overall texture.
Morpheus8, on the other hand, is a fractional radiofrequency microneedling device. It combines the benefits of microneedling with RF energy to penetrate deep into the skin. The fractional approach allows for more precise treatment, targeting specific areas while promoting a faster healing process.
Treatment Areas and Results
Profound RF is particularly effective for treating larger areas of the face and body, such as the cheeks, jawline, and abdomen. It is known for its ability to produce significant tightening and lifting effects, making it a popular choice for those seeking a more youthful appearance.
Morpheus8 is versatile and can be used on both the face and body. It is often favored for its ability to address fine lines, acne scars, and uneven skin texture. The fractional nature of the treatment allows for a more controlled and targeted approach, which can be beneficial for smaller, more delicate areas.
